Grafton Mews is in London and in Camden district. W1T 5JE is located in the Bloomsbury elect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Holborn and St Pancras. This postcode has been in use since 2000-12-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around W1T 5JE,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 65%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Safety

Is Grafton Mews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Grafton Mews was 2428.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 232.9% higher than the Bloomsbury average. The most reported crime type was Theft from the person.

Grafton Mews has the 7th highest crime rate of 76 local areas in Bloomsbury and the 9th highest crime rate of 567 local areas in Camden .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 486.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 3.3%.
